tbh the sheer amount of athlete/manager press conferences is a big reason why sports journalism in general is so shitty.
Most sports reporters are stuck in an endless routine of match reports >> post-match press conference >> post-match analysis that they never actually get the time or resources to write or pursue bigger stories. As a result, they get way too reliant on the presser either to generate stories or to get soundbites for the story they've already written.

Yep. Soderling (r4, 2009) and Djokovic (qf, 2015) actually beat him; Djokovic additionally stretched him to a 5-set semi and two 4-set finals. Federer took a set in four of his six defeats. Isner led two sets to one in the opening round in 2011.
The list of players who have taken one set probably isn't that long either.

Yeah, the degree of randomisation in the seed bracketing is never really clear to me. Of course, 1-16 will always play 17-32 in the third round, and so on, but at some events it seems absolutely fixed as opposite ranks (1v32, 2v31, 3v30, 4v29, etc), others there's leeway of one or more place, others it's genuinely random within those ranking divisions.
From my youth I remember McEnroe (1) playing Kriek (5) in a Wimb qf, and the next year Connors (1) playing Curren (12) in the last sixteen. So I've been puzzling about this for 40 years! Maybe that was some weird AELTC experiment.
